Diagnosis
A diagnosis of adhd diagnosis online is the first step in getting the support you need. An ADHD assessment could be beneficial in the event that you are trying to receive disability benefits or make reasonable adjustments at school or work. You can be referred by your GP, or pay for an independent specialist. Do your research prior to choosing an independent service. You can find out about local services through word-of-mouth or through online reviews. In London, the cost of a private diagnosis can vary between PS500 to PS1,200. In addition to an ADHD evaluation A private psychiatrist will typically also look for and treat co-morbidities, such as anxiety or depression.
Unfortunately the NHS struggles to meet the demands for adult ADHD assessment for adults with ADHD. Many GPs will not recommend patients due to a lack of the necessary knowledge or training. Others are overwhelmed by the volume of people seeking diagnosis, which is increasing rapidly as the public becomes more aware of ADHD and neurodiversity. Panorama showed that some people are taking shortcuts to receive an ADHD diagnose.
If your GP isn't willing to refer you for an assessment, inquire about the reason. If they say that they have financial reasons, you should consider finding a new doctor - especially if your goal is to sign a Shared care agreement for your medication in the future. The Psychiatry-UK website has some great tips for doing this, including template forms and letters you can use.
Once you have received a referral, choose your private ADHD assessment provider carefully. You should ensure they are members of the General Medical Council and that their specialist registrar is trained in adult ADHD. The service must follow the NICE guidelines on adult ADHD assessments.
After the examination, you will receive a report from your clinician and an outline of the next steps. If you are deemed to be in need, you will be asked to discuss the possibility of a medical treatment using stimulants. You may be requested to attend regular meetings with a clinical psychologist, an occupational therapist or other healthcare professionals.

Medication
A private ADHD assessment will enable you to get a diagnosis and treatment from a professional in the field. The process is generally extensive and involves a lengthy consultation with a psychiatrist and typically, the need to fill in school reports. The psychiatrist will also need to determine if your symptoms have been present since childhood. It can be difficult for older people who may not have their old school records. The psychiatric doctor will also examine any family history of mental health issues and search for any co-morbidities such as depression or anxiety which are common in ADHD.
Many private companies offer ADHD assessments via Skype or over the phone. This is a great alternative for those who live far away from the best clinics in the UK. This kind of evaluation is less expensive than an NHS Maudsley referral and it is much faster. However it is important to remember that a private evaluation doesn't mean that you will automatically be prescribed medication. A lot of GPs will not sign a'shared-care agreement' with a patient who has been diagnosed privately, particularly if they have not been properly titrated to a final dosage of medication.

Receiving an ADHD diagnosis is not an easy process. You will need to see an experienced psychiatrist for a thorough assessment. The psychiatrist will look at your current issues as well as those that you experienced in the past in your childhood. The doctor might also request evidence, such as old school records. The psychiatrist will determine whether your ADHD symptoms cause significant impairment. The psychiatrist will also assess your comorbidity. This refers to any other mental disorders.
The diagnosis will take about 2 hours minimum. The specialist will test you for each of the three main characteristics of ADHD: inattentiveness, hyperactivity and impulsivity. The psychiatrist will then use these assessments to determine whether you are a candidate for ADHD. Some people with ADHD exhibit all three symptoms while others show a mixture of symptoms.
